The remains of the ancient settlement of Burdapa and a nearby sanctuary dedicated to the Three Nymphs are located in the Ognyanovo area. Votive tablets and statues of the Three Nymphs, Zeus and Hera, as well as jewelry, coins, terracottas, ceramics and lamps, were found there.
The Sanctuary of the Three Nymphs near Ognyanovo is described as one of the largest sanctuaries of the Three Nymphs in Pazardzhik Municipality.
The surrounding area of Ognyanovo also contains Old Bridge, Gradishteto, the Kurshunlu Mosque, the Church of St. Petka and the Church of the Virgin Mary.
Elenski Vrah is located in the nearby area of Ognyanovo. Turska Glava and Mal Tepe are located in the wider regional surroundings of Ognyanovo.
In the wider area around Ognyanovo, the remains of an early Christian basilica are preserved on Elenski Vrah. The Chapel of St. Nicholas at the site of Manastircheto is associated with the Middle Ages and the National Revival period.
